I ran up the nurse at my GP clinic and said I was ttc and would like a presciption for folic acid and iodine. Cost $3 for 3 months. Elevit is $45 a month but also has iron and other vitamins in it too. Its the folic acid and idodine that are recommended for all preg women and ideally taken 3 months prior to preg also.
